Noise Levels and Privacy

One thing people often overlook, but is super important, is the noise level and your sense of privacy. After all, you want your apartment to be your sanctuary, right? No one wants to hear their neighbors stomping around all day or be kept up all night by loud music. Reviews often mention the level of noise from neighboring apartments, common areas, or nearby streets. Pay attention to these comments, especially if you're sensitive to noise. Some buildings have better soundproofing than others, so it's worth investigating this aspect before you sign a lease. Privacy is another key consideration. Do the apartments have good window coverings to block out unwanted views? Are the balconies or patios designed to provide a sense of seclusion? Some residents may also comment on the level of foot traffic in the hallways or common areas, which can impact your sense of privacy. If you value peace and quiet, look for reviews that mention these factors. You might also want to visit the property at different times of day to get a sense of the typical noise levels and activity. Talking to current residents can also provide valuable insights. Keep in mind that noise levels can vary depending on the location of your apartment within the complex. Apartments near elevators, stairwells, or parking lots may be noisier than those located further away.
